Abstract

An exhaust gas purification catalyst includes a catalytic layer on a carrier, in which a particle component A and a particle component B are mixed. The particle component A is composed of catalytic-metal-doped CeZr-based mixed oxide powder, and has a particle size distribution with a peak in a particle size range of equal to or greater than 100 nm and equal to or less than 300 nm. A CeO/(CeO+ZrO) mass ratio of CeZr-based mixed oxide is equal to or greater than 30% and equal to or less than 75%. The particle component B is composed of at least one selected from a group consisting of activated alumina powder, Zr-based-oxide-supported alumina powder, and catalytic-metal-undoped CeZr-based mixed oxide powder. At least a part of particles of the particle component B has a particle size larger than that of the particle component A.
